softura-marketing · 2 months
What are the potential cost savings and cost considerations associated with software outsourcing? Outsourcing software provides businesses with a number of potential cost savings and factors to consider: Labor expense Reduction: Labor expense reduction is one of the primary benefits of software outsourcing. Organizations may benefit from the knowledge and proficiency of proficient experts by outsourcing to countries with reduced labor expenses in contrast to domestic markets. This practice allows organizations to acquire exceptional personnel at a considerably reduced expenditure, leading to substantial savings on wages, benefits, and operational costs. Reduced Infrastructure Expenses: By delegating software development to an external provider, organizations can circumvent the financial burden of procuring costly equipment, software licenses, and infrastructure necessary for internal development. By virtue of the infrastructure and resources typically possessed by outsourcing partners, organizations can circumvent the initial capital investments and continuous maintenance expenses that are linked to the upkeep of an internal development team. Allocation of Flexible Resources: Software outsourcing enables organizations to adjust the size of their development teams in accordance with the demands of specific projects. By engaging with outsourcing partners on a project-by-project basis, businesses can easily alter resource allocation during periods of fluctuating demand, as opposed to hiring and training new employees or laying off existing staff. This adaptability assists organizations in maximizing resource utilization and minimizing wasteful expenditures. An accelerated time-to-market can be achieved by outsourcing software development to seasoned professionals, which enables organizations to bring their products and services to market more quickly. Frequently, the domain knowledge and specialized abilities of outsourcing partners enable them to execute projects efficiently and satisfy strict deadlines. In addition to expediting the generation of prospective revenue streams, accelerating time-to-market decreases the opportunity costs that accompany delayed product launches. Risk Mitigation: Although organizations do prioritize cost savings, they must also assess potential risks that may arise from software outsourcing, including but not limited to communication difficulties, safeguarding intellectual property, and vendor dependability. By maintaining open channels of communication with outsourcing partners, investing in due diligence, and establishing transparent contractual agreements, these risks can be mitigated and a successful outsourcing engagement can be ensured.
0 notes
softura-marketing · 2 months
How does ChatGPT assist in enhancing user engagement and interactivity within legacy application environments?
ChatGPT is a highly effective instrument that optimizes user interaction and engagement in legacy application environments through the utilization of its sophisticated natural language processing functionalities. Using its integration, ChatGPT enhances user experiences by enabling intuitive interactions, delivering personalized assistance, and augmenting functionality within pre-existing systems. In the first place, ChatGPT increases user engagement through the provision of individualized, need-specific assistance. Through the comprehension of natural language inputs, the system is capable of deciphering user inquiries and delivering pertinent replies, suggestions, or actions within the environment of the legacy application. By adopting a personalized approach, an atmosphere of responsiveness and connection is created, which in turn increases user satisfaction and retention. Additionally, ChatGPT promotes natural and effortless interactions by allowing users to exchange common language with legacy applications. The application's conversational interface streamlines intricate processes, thereby diminishing the acquisition of knowledge for users and fostering inclusivity for individuals with varying degrees of expertise. The implementation of this conversational paradigm in legacy application environments ultimately improves the user experience by fostering active engagement and enhancing usability. Additionally, ChatGPT expands the capabilities of antiquated applications through its ability to seamlessly integrate with contemporary technologies and services. ChatGPT is capable of accessing external data sources, executing complex computations, and performing duties on behalf of users within the pre-existing application ecosystem due to its adaptable architecture and API integrations. By increasing the value proposition of legacy applications and enabling the use of new capabilities, this interoperability increases user engagement and satisfaction.
0 notes
softura-marketing · 2 months
What strategies do mobile application development services employ to optimize app monetization and revenue generation?
Mobile application development services maximize app monetization and revenue generation through the implementation of the following strategies: The practice of incorporating advertisements into the user interface of an application is widely employed. Ad formats such as banners, interstitials, rewarded videos, and native ads can be utilized by developers to optimize revenue generation while maintaining a satisfactory user experience. The freemium model, which entails supplying an app with restricted functionality in exchange for a fee and offering premium features or content, is a widely adopted method of generating revenue. Users may purchase in-app items or convert to a paid version in order to remove advertisements or gain access to additional features. By enabling users to purchase virtual products, upgrades, or subscriptions directly within the application, in-app purchases (IAPs) can serve as a highly profitable source of revenue. Tailored to the niche of their application, developers may offer consumable goods, non-consumable features, or subscriptions. The implementation of a subscription-based model enables developers to remunerate users with access to exclusive features, premium content, or services. This methodology promotes consistent revenue generation and sustains user involvement in the long run. Affiliate marketing involves forging alliances with pertinent brands or organizations and endorsing their products or services within the application, thereby potentially augmenting revenue via affiliate commissions. Affiliate links, referral programs, and sponsored content can be seamlessly integrated into the application experience by developers. Data monetization refers to the profitable practice of gathering anonymized user data and utilizing it to generate insights, market research, or targeted advertising. To maintain credibility and trust, however, developers must prioritize user privacy and comply with data protection regulations. By employing analytics tools to monitor user behavior, engagement metrics, and conversion rates, developers are able to efficiently optimize their monetization strategies. Through the analysis of data insights, developers are able to refine pricing models, ad placements, and content offerings with well-informed decisions.
0 notes
softura-marketing · 2 months
SharePoint Online effectively supports team communication and project collaboration within heterogeneous work environments in what ways? SharePoint Online functions as a robust platform that facilitates project collaboration and promotes team communication across various work settings by virtue of its wide range of functionalities and attributes. To begin with, SharePoint Online provides a centralized solution for document management, enabling teams to store, organize, and retrieve files from any location that has an internet connection. This mechanism guarantees that all team members, irrespective of their geographical placement, are equipped with the most current information, thereby promoting cooperation and efficiency. Furthermore, by integrating with Microsoft Teams, Outlook, and various other Office 365 applications, SharePoint Online facilitates streamlined communication. By employing functionalities such as discussion boards, announcements, and notifications, teams can effectively coordinate tasks, share updates, and facilitate real-time communication. Additionally, SharePoint Online fosters accountability and transparency through the provision of audit traces and version control for projects and documents. By providing team members with the ability to monitor modifications, access document history, and identify contributors, trust is increased, and collaboration is facilitated. Also, SharePoint Online provides the capability to personalize team sites and project portals, enabling groups to establish environments that precisely cater to their unique requirements. These websites may feature custom forms, calendars, task lists, and protocols, enabling teams to effectively manage projects and remain organized. Moreover, SharePoint Online facilitates the incorporation of third-party applications and services, allowing teams to benefit from supplementary functionalities and tools that bolster efficiency and cooperation.
0 notes
softura-marketing · 2 months
Regarding prioritizing applications for modernization within an organization, what are the most effective practices?
The strategic process of prioritizing applications for modernization necessitates meticulous deliberation of a multitude of factors. The following are several recommended approaches that can provide guidance to organizations regarding this pivotal undertaking:
1. Alignment on a Strategic Level: Ensure congruence with the overarching strategy and objectives of the organization. Applicants that make direct contributions to strategic objectives, thereby bolstering competitiveness and facilitating long-term vision, should be given priority. 2. Business Impact Assessment: Perform an exhaustive assessment of the business impact associated with every application. In order to ensure the greatest possible positive impact on revenue, cost reduction, customer satisfaction, and other critical performance indicators, prioritize those that can do so. 3. Assessment of Technical Debt: Determine which applications are overburdened with excessive technical debt, obsolete technologies, or reliance on obsolete components. Prioritize the following, as technical debt-related hazards may be mitigated through modernization. 4. User Experience and Feedback: Take user feedback and experiences with existing applications into consideration. In accordance with user feedback, prioritize those with usability issues or high demand for enhancements, as improving the user experience can result in favorable organizational outcomes. 5. Performance and Scalability: Evaluate applications that are encountering challenges related to scalability and performance. In order to optimize the performance of these applications in the face of heightened burdens, modernization initiatives should take precedence. 6. Ensuring Regulatory Compliance and Security: Give precedence to applications that present vulnerabilities in terms of security or compliance. Efforts towards modernization ought to incorporate measures to strengthen the security posture of critical applications and comply with regulatory obligations. 7. Maintenance Costs: Assess the recurring maintenance expenses associated with each application. Modernizing assets that require the most money to maintain can result in substantial cost savings over time. 8. Complicatedty and efficacy: Take into account the complexity and efficacy of modernizing individual applications. Give precedence to applications for which modernization endeavors are probable to be uncomplicated and realizable within the limitations of the organization. 9. Vendor Support and Product Lifecycle: Evaluate the product lifecycle and vendor support of third-party applications. Application end-of-life and unsupported applications that may present security and compatibility concerns should be given precedence. 10. Opportunities for Innovation: Determine which applications can benefit from modernization by incorporating novel features or technologies that confer a competitive edge. Give precedence to applications that are in line with the innovation objectives of the organization and prevailing market trends.
0 notes
softura-marketing · 2 months
Regarding conventional IT infrastructure, what are the financial ramifications of cloud enablement? The cost ramifications of cloud enablement in comparison to conventional IT infrastructure are complex and contingent upon a multitude of elements, such as the magnitude of activities, utilization of resources, and particular needs of the institution. Listed below are the most important expense considerations: 1. The establishment of conventional IT infrastructure generally necessitates a substantial initial capital outlay for hardware, servers, networking equipment, and data centers. On the other hand, cloud enablement obviates the necessity for significant financial investments through the implementation of a pay-as-you-go pricing framework, whereby organizations are solely responsible for paying for the resources they utilize, without worrying about the procurement and upkeep of tangible infrastructure. 2. Cloud enablement presents a financial benefit in the form of reduced operational expenses when compared to conventional IT infrastructure. Cloud service providers oversee and maintain the foundational infrastructure, which comprises duties such as software updates, hardware upkeep, and security patches. This alleviates organizations from the operational strain and empowers them to allocate resources towards critical business operations rather than IT maintenance obligations. 3. Scalability and Flexibility: The implementation of cloud enablement grants organizations the ability to adjust resource allocation in response to fluctuations in demand, thereby facilitating enhanced resource utilization and cost optimization. Scaling resources with conventional IT infrastructure frequently necessitates time-consuming and expensive hardware purchases and infrastructure enhancements. 4. The total cost of ownership (TCO) should be taken into account by organizations, despite the potential cost benefits of cloud enablement in relation to initial investment and ongoing operational expenditures. The overall cost of cloud services may be influenced by various factors, including storage costs, data transfer fees, and usage-based pricing models. It is crucial to consider these elements in conjunction with the potential benefits. 5. The implementation of efficient cost management and optimization strategies is critical in order to optimize the advantages offered by cloud enablement while reducing superfluous expenditures. It is imperative for organizations to exercise oversight over resource utilization, establish mechanisms for cost allocation, and employ cloud management tools in order to maximize expenditures and guarantee the economical application of cloud resources.
0 notes
softura-marketing · 3 months
In what ways do cloud services assist organizations in improved scalability and flexibility? The manner in organizations oversee their IT infrastructure has been revolutionized by Cloud services, which provide flexibility and scalability that are unmatched in the ability to adapt to changing business requirements. In the contemporary and fiercely competitive environment, the capacity to adjust and adjust resources in response to evolving demands is pivotal for the achievement of organizational objectives. Cloud services provide organizations with increased scalability and flexibility via a number of critical mechanisms: 1. Resource Allocation on Demand: Cloud platforms empower enterprises to adjust the magnitude of computing resources in response to fluctuations in demand. This enables organizations to efficiently distribute surplus storage, processing capabilities, or network bandwidth in response to demands, unencumbered by physical infrastructure constraints. By allowing for resource reductions during off-peak hours and scaling up during periods of high utilization, cloud services offer the adaptability necessary to efficiently address fluctuating demands. 2. Elasticity: Cloud services provide the capability for organizations to dynamically modify resource capacity in accordance with fluctuations in workload. Elastic scaling enables organizations to effectively manage abrupt increases in traffic or workload without encountering any negative impact on performance. This capability optimizes resource utilization and cost-effectiveness while ensuring peak demand periods are accompanied by optimal performance and user experience. 3. Payment Model: Cloud services are supported by a pricing structure known as "pay-per-use," in which organizations remit payment solely for the resources they utilize. This economical methodology obviates the necessity for initial capital expenditures on hardware and infrastructure, thereby enabling organizations of varying scales and financial capacities to access cloud services. Through the synchronization of costs with tangible utilization, cloud services empower organizations to maximize their IT expenditures and expand activities without excessively allocating resources. 4. Worldwide Availability: Cloud services afford organizations global reach and accessibility, as they can be accessed from any location with an internet connection. This capability allows enterprises to establish a closer connection between their services and end-users, resulting in decreased latency and enhanced user satisfaction in various geographical areas. 5. Streamlined Development and Deployment: By providing a variety of tools and services for development and deployment, cloud platforms enable businesses to streamline the software development lifecycle. Cloud services enable initiatives such as container orchestration and automated deployment pipelines to streamline development processes, reduce time-to-market, and foster increased innovation. 6. Cloud services offer disaster recovery and business continuity functionalities as standard features, guaranteeing redundant data, failover mechanisms, and automated backups. By replicating their data and applications across multiple geographic regions, organizations can reduce the likelihood of unanticipated data loss or outage. In essence, cloud services provide organizations with the ability to effectively expand their operations, optimize the utilization of resources, and swiftly adapt to evolving business demands. Through the utilization of cloud services' scalability and flexibility, organizations have the ability to foster innovation, improve agility, and sustain a competitive advantage in the contemporary digital environment.
1 note · View note